Papa Steve's Sourdough Pizza ( Boudin Walnut Creek 12 Broadway Ln)
3.8 x (18) • Pizza • American • Breakfast and Brunch • Desserts • $ • Info
12 Broadway Ln Ste 1000
Get it delivered to your door.
x $0 delivery fee
Other fees x
Enter address
to see delivery time
Sunday
10:00 AM - 8:00 PM
Monday - Saturday
10:00 AM - 9:00 PM
Pizzas
Beverages